   MESOSCALE DISCUSSION 1687
   NWS STORM PREDICTION CENTER NORMAN OK
   1150 AM CDT FRI JUL 22 2011
   
   AREAS AFFECTED...FAR SRN LOWER MI...NRN IND AND WRN/NRN OH
   
   CONCERNING...SEVERE POTENTIAL...WATCH LIKELY 
   
   VALID 221650Z - 221745Z
   
   WATCH LIKELY WILL BE ISSUED SOON AS THUNDERSTORM LINE...IN THE LOWER
   GREAT LAKES REGION...IS EXPECTED TO INTENSIFY. OTHER STORMS ARE ALSO
   LIKELY TO DEVELOP/INTENSIFY AHEAD OF THE LINE IN VERY UNSTABLE AND
   HOT AIR MASS. DEEP LAYER SHEAR AT 20-30 KT AND MLCAPES AOA 4000 J/KG
   WILL SUPPORT MOSTLY A SEVERE WIND THREAT.
